📖 Overview

Limnocottus Bergianus (Limnocottus bergianus) is a ray-finned fish of the family Abyssocottidae. It inhabits freshwater waters in deep-water environments. This species can reach a maximum total length of 22.5 cm. It occurs at depths between 100 and 1000 metres. With a trophic level of 3.9, it is a mid-level predator. It is assessed as Least Concern on the IUCN Red List.

🌍 Habitat & Distribution

Freshwater; bathydemersal; depth range 100 - 1000 m . Deep-water Endemic to Lake Baikal, Russia.
